Fixed point free automorphisms of groups related to finite fields
Let G = Fqo 〈β〉 be the semidirect product of the additive group of the field of q = p elements and the cyclic group of order d generated by the invertible linear transformation β defined by multiplication by a power of a primitive root of Fq. متن کاملAutomorphisms of Free Groups Have Finitely Generated Fixed Point Sets
An automorphism of a finitely generated free group F extends to a homeomorphism of the end completion E of F. The set of fixed points of this homeomorphism is finitely generated in a certain sense. In particular this implies that the subgroup of elements fixed by the automorphism is finitely generated in the usual sense. متن کاملFinite Fixed Point Free Automorphism Groups
Preface A famous theorem by Frobenius in 1901 proves that if a group G contains a proper non trivial subgroup H such that H ∩ g −1 Hg = {1 G } for all g ∈ G \ H, then there exists a normal subgroup N such that G is the semidirect product of N and H.
